Lunchtime Supervisor job summary
Actual salary: £5,424 - £5,637
10 hours per week, term time only
Required to start possibly from 15th June 2026 (a later date can be discussed).
The Governors at Our Lady & St Benedict’s are looking to appoint a Lunchtime Supervisor to work amongst our school’s small and committed staff team. The successful candidate will support the Academy Manager, parents and other colleagues to help create an effective, safe and purposeful learning environment.
Your main responsibilities will be to work with our Academy Manager & lunchtime team to provide an enriching lunchtime break for the pupils.
The successful candidate will require the ability to communicate effectively with a wide audience including teaching staff, students and parents, as well as the wider community. A flexible and practical approach, and a 'can do' attitude would also be desirable.

Commitment to safeguarding
Our organisation is committed to safeguarding and promoting the welfare of children, young people and vulnerable adults. We expect all staff, volunteers and trustees to share this commitment.
Our recruitment process follows the keeping children safe in education guidance.
Offers of employment may be subject to the following checks (where relevant):
childcare disqualification
Disclosure and Barring Service (DBS)
medical
online and social media
prohibition from teaching
right to work
satisfactory references
suitability to work with children
You must tell us about any unspent conviction, cautions, reprimands or warnings under the Rehabilitation of Offenders Act 1974 (Exceptions) Order 1975.
